The Effect of Humidity on Paint Drying Time



You're probably asking yourself how the humidity outside can influence your paint project, well let me tell you, it can really decrease the drying out time of your paint!

When the air is humid, it is saturated with wetness, and this can trigger your paint to take a lot longer to completely dry than it would certainly in a drier environment. This is since the water in the paint requires to vaporize in order for the paint to dry, and when the air is currently filled with dampness, it can't soak up any more, which decreases the drying out process.

The influence of humidity on your paint project can be much more substantial if you are repainting in an improperly ventilated area, as the dampness in the air will certainly have nowhere to go, and will simply remain around your job, making the drying time also longer.

The most effective way to combat the results of moisture on your painting task is to pick a day when the weather is completely dry, or to paint throughout a time of day when the moisture is reduced, such as very early in the early morning or later on at night. Additionally, you can make use of a dehumidifier or a fan to help circulate the air and accelerate the drying out time.

Tips for Picking the very best Climate Condition for Your House Painting Project



Optimal painting problems require cautious consideration of elements such as temperature, humidity, and wind speed to ensure a smooth and also complete. When planning your house painting project, it's important to choose the most effective climate condition to avoid any incidents or hold-ups.

Here are some ideas to help you choose the ideal weather for your painting project:



- Check the weather forecast: Prior to starting your project, make sure to check the weather prediction for the following few days. Avoid paint on days with high humidity or strong winds, as these conditions can influence the paint's adhesion and drying time.

- Aim for moderate temperatures: Severe temperature levels can impact the uniformity of the paint and cause it to dry also promptly or not whatsoever. Aim for temperature levels in between 50 and 85 levels Fahrenheit for optimum paint problems.

- Stay clear of straight sunshine: Paint in straight sunshine can create the paint to completely dry also swiftly, causing unequal coverage and blistering. Choose a day with partial shade or wait until the sunlight has actually passed over your house.

- Think about the time of day: Paint in the late afternoon or early evening can be a good option as the temperature and humidity degrees have a tendency to be reduced. Nevertheless, see to it to complete painting prior to it obtains also dark to avoid any kind of mistakes.
